# Addrly Widget — Environments

The address autocomplete widget runs in three environments: dev, staging, prod. Dev points at a synthetic gazetteer with fake streets; never demo from it. Staging mirrors prod data weekly and is the only place to test ranking changes. Prod deploys go through the Lanternway pipeline with a mandatory canary. Feature flags are per-environment and do not inherit, a common source of confusion. Each environment reads its settings at startup from the block of values below.

deployment values, kajep-kageg:
[praix]
host = praix.paliqcorp.corp
user = praix_svc
database = praix_prod

## Key Ceremony Checklist — Item 7

- [ ] Verify the Gleamtrace GPU profiler signing key is loaded on the offline laptop before anyone touches the Hexfern HSM. Plugin authors: your profiling hooks won't validate without this key, so double-check the fingerprint against the printed sheet. If the laptop won't unlock, the ceremony lead reads out the recovery passphrase below.

recovery phrase for bawef-haduf: wenax-druox-julmir

Release manager: Thursday's Grayhollow drill fails over the Quartzen search cluster to the Ashpool region. The relevance tuning notes from last sprint (synonym weights, decay curves) live only in the primary's config store, so snapshot them before cutover or the replayed index will score stale. Hold the 5.2 release until the drill report clears. Post-drill, diff the scoring configs and flag drift in the release notes. To export the config snapshot, unlock the tooling vault with the recovery passphrase below.

unlock words, bajop-hafog: tamdor-kelix-pelys-eliys-gormir-wenys-novath-holiel-belael-quenion-istax-quenius-eliir